Living in Buckhurst Hill offers families the perfect blend of suburban charm and convenience, with an excellent selection of schools and green spaces right on the doorstep. The area is well known for its strong sense of community and family-friendly atmosphere, making it an ideal place to settle and grow.

Parents will appreciate the highly regarded local schooling options, including Buckhurst Hill Community Primary School (BHCP) and St John’s Church of England Primary School, both known for their nurturing environments and strong academic standards. For older students, West Hatch and Roding Valley High School provide excellent secondary education options, ensuring quality learning throughout every stage.

With beautiful Epping Forest nearby and a vibrant Queens Road offering cafés, boutiques, and transport links into London, Buckhurst Hill is a wonderful place for families to call home.
